Fire breaks out in private school van on BBwala Road, Bathinda, driver saves 35 children

A private school van caught fire on BBwala Road in Bathinda on Saturday, prompting panic. Quick action by the driver prevented any casualties, rescuing all 35 children on board.
On Saturday, a private school transport van ignited on BBwala Road in Bathinda, Punjab, when smoke started billowing from its engine. The sudden blaze startled the children and bystanders, creating a scene of chaos.
The van's driver, noticing the flames, immediately halted the vehicle, opened the doors and guided the 35 students out of the vehicle. Thanks to his swift response, none of the children suffered injuries, and the fire was contained before it could spread.
Local fire‑brigade units arrived within minutes, doused the remaining flames and began an investigation into the cause of the fire. Authorities have urged schools to review safety protocols for school transport and ensure regular vehicle maintenance.
Police have filed a preliminary report and are coordinating with the school administration to assess any further safety measures required.
The incident underscores the importance of vigilance by drivers and the need for stringent checks on school vehicles to protect young passengers.
